Common faults and abnormalities of transformers

Transformer faults can be divided into internal faults and external faults.

Internal faults refer to faults that occur inside the casing, including phase-to-phase short-circuit faults of windings, inter-turn short-circuit faults of one-phase windings, short-circuit faults between windings and iron cores, and wire break faults of windings.

External faults refer to various phase-to-phase short-circuit faults between external lead-out wires of transformers, and single-phase grounding faults caused by flashover of lead-out insulation bushings through the casing.

Transformer faults are very harmful. Especially when internal faults occur, the high-temperature arc generated by the short-circuit current will not only burn the insulation and iron core of the transformer windings, but also cause the transformer oil to decompose and produce a large amount of gas due to heat, causing the transformer casing to deform or even explode. Therefore, the transformer must be removed when it fails.

The abnormal conditions of the transformer mainly include overload, oil level reduction, overcurrent caused by external short circuit, excessive oil temperature of the operating transformer, excessive winding temperature, excessive transformer pressure, and cooling system failure. When the transformer is in an abnormal operating state, an alarm signal should be given.
